feat: focus-triggered MS To-Do delta sync for near-instant change reflection
Pull-sync now runs on visibilitychange + window focus (in addition to mount
and the slow 15-min safety-net interval), throttled to one call per 5s. The
moment the user returns to the tab the app reconciles, so an Outlook-side
checkbox/star/title change shows up within a second of refocusing the tab
instead of after a 15-minute wait.
To keep this cheap, the Microsoft Graph delta endpoint
(/me/todo/lists/{id}/tasks/delta) is used when we have a stored deltaToken
for a synced list — typically a few hundred bytes per call when nothing
changed. Tokens are persisted on SomedayList.syncDeltaToken (new column,
migration applied) and refreshed each call. On 410 Gone (token expired
>30 days) we fall back to a full fetch and prime a new chain. Delta also
brings remote deletions (@removed) so they propagate locally without
needing a full list scan.
